      <description>&lt;P&gt;This is because the toolpath runs into the maximum of the rotary limits.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;It can work around this by what we call the rewind Logic. That means if it runs into the -30 limit of the A-Axis it will retract the tool, move the A-axis to 30. (Flip the B or C-axis 180 degrees as well) and come back in.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Not sure on your post, but in the latest Haas with trunnion post this is built in but needs activation: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Find the latest post here:&amp;nbsp;&lt;A href="http://cam.autodesk.com/posts/?p=haas_trunnion" target="_blank"&gt;http://cam.autodesk.com/posts/?p=haas_trunnion&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You need to change this: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;PRE&gt;// Start of onRewindMachine logic
/***** Be sure to add 'safeRetractDistance' to post properties. *****/
var performRewinds = false; // enables the onRewindMachine logic&lt;/PRE&gt;
&lt;P&gt;To this: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;PRE&gt;// Start of onRewindMachine logic
/***** Be sure to add 'safeRetractDistance' to post properties. *****/
var performRewinds = true; // enables the onRewindMachine logic&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;a href="https://forums.autodesk.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/1941261"&gt;@Laurens-3DTechDraw&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ks for the help. I did some more digging into the post and discovered it incorrectly set the machine limits which is why I was getting the rewind.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I am using the UMC750 post which by default has the B-axis limited from 0 to 110 instead of the machine's actual limits of -35 to 110. I altered the post and am now good to go!&lt;/P&gt;</description>
